However, below are a few of the most usual and essential examinations for well water: Microorganisms: Checking for coliform bacteria is very important since these microorganisms can show the existence of various other dangerous bacteria, such as E. coli, that can trigger ailment if consumed - Well Water Testing. Nitrate: Nitrate is a typical impurity in agricultural areas and can originate from plant foods, manure, or various other resources


p, H: p, H is a step of the level of acidity or alkalinity of the water. Water that is also acidic or also alkaline can trigger corrosion in pipes and various other tools, which can influence the taste and high quality of the water. Water Well in Homeowners Backyard Total dissolved solids (TDS): TDS determines the quantity of minerals and other compounds in the water, consisting of salts, steels, and various other dissolved solids.




Arsenic: Arsenic is a normally taking place component that can be located in groundwater. High degrees of arsenic in alcohol consumption water can create skin problems, cancer, and other health issue. Radon: Radon is a radioactive gas that can be discovered in groundwater and can position a health and wellness danger if it gathers in indoor air.

Yearly Checking of Your Well Water will certainly Notify You of Pollutants, Tidy drinking water is something the majority of people take for granted in New England. The area has a few of the cleanest resources of water on the planet, but pollutants, both normally taking place and manufactured, can locate their way into water supplies.Water from public systems are highly managed and frequently evaluated. The New Hampshire Department of Environmental Providers suggests that all home owners with personal wells evaluate their water regularly to make sure the high quality is high. Conventional analysis is a basic examination that covers the most common impurities discovered in alcohol consumption water. Some of these posture a health threat, while others only impact the taste or smell of water. Radon is a naturally occurring gas that is frequently located in bedrock throughout New Hampshire and impacts about one-third of exclusive wells the state. There are no state or government radon standards, only recommended activity degrees . Examinations for radon are recommended and could be called for by your community or your home mortgage lender.Volatile organic chemicals can stem from manufacturing plants or gasoline station.The Centers for Illness Control and Avoidance recommend checking your well every springtime for mechanical troubles and screening for contaminants once a year. The New Hampshire Department of Environmental Services says these examinations can be expanded over significant time periods because a change to water quality typically occurs gradually. Nitrates are an all-natural part of plants and nitrate-containing fertilizers. They can permeate right into well water and can posture poisonous threat to people.

Boiling doesn't eliminate them. In babies, nitrates can bring Get More Info about an unsafe problem called methemoglobinemia. This is a blood problem that hinders the circulation of oxygen in the blood. Formula that is prepared with well water may place infants at danger of nitrate poisoning. If your well water contains a level above 10 mg/L, it must not be utilized in infant formula or food.
